Citigroup's traders drove the bank to its highest quarterly revenue in a decade, with fixed-income revenue reaching $5.2 billion in the first quarter. The result points to strong trading performance and improved core banking fundamentals. The article is brief and does not include a broader outlook or other operating metrics.
